li::marker{display:none}h1{font-size:var(--header-level_1-font-size);font-weight:var(--header-level_1-font-weight)}h2{font-size:var(--header-level_2-font-size);font-weight:var(--header-level_2-font-weight)}h3{font-size:var(--header-level_3-font-size);font-weight:var(--header-level_3-font-weight)}.VideoPlayer{height:0;position:relative;width:100%}.VideoPlayer iframe{border:none;height:100%;width:100%}.VideoPlayer:not([class*=aspect-ratio]){padding-bottom:56.25%}.react-calendar{font-family:Arial,Helvetica,sans-serif;line-height:1.125em;max-width:100%}.react-calendar--doubleView{width:700px}.react-calendar--doubleView .react-calendar__viewContainer{display:flex;margin:-.5em}.react-calendar--doubleView .react-calendar__viewContainer>*{margin:.5em;width:50%}.react-calendar,.react-calendar *,.react-calendar :after,.react-calendar :before{-moz-box-sizing:border-box;-webkit-box-sizing:border-box;box-sizing:border-box}.react-calendar button{border:0;margin:0;outline:none}.react-calendar button:disabled{color:#5a5c5d;pointer-events:none}.react-calendar button:enabled:hover{cursor:pointer}.react-calendar__navigation{color:#fff;display:flex;height:32px;margin-bottom:24px}.react-calendar__navigation__arrow{width:32px}.react-calendar__navigation__arrow img{margin:auto;max-width:18px}.react-calendar__navigation button{background:none}.react-calendar__navigation button:disabled{visibility:hidden}button.react-calendar__navigation__label:enabled:focus,button.react-calendar__navigation__label:enabled:hover{cursor:auto}.react-calendar__navigation__label__labelText{font-family:var(--typography-family-body);font-size:1.25rem;font-weight:600;line-height:1.875rem}.react-calendar__month-view__weekdays{margin-bottom:16px;text-align:center}.react-calendar__month-view__weekdays__weekday{flex:unset!important;font-family:var(--typography-family-body);font-size:.75rem;height:18px;line-height:1.125rem;max-width:32px;padding:0;width:32px;@media (min-width:2000px){max-width:30px}}.react-calendar__month-view__days__day--neighboringMonth{visibility:hidden}.react-calendar__navigation__next2-button,.react-calendar__navigation__prev2-button{display:none}.react-calendar__month-view__weekNumbers .react-calendar__tile{display:flex;font-size:.75em;font-weight:700}.react-calendar__century-view .react-calendar__tile,.react-calendar__decade-view .react-calendar__tile,.react-calendar__year-view .react-calendar__tile{padding:2em .5em}.react-calendar__tile{background:none;color:#fff;flex:unset!important;font-family:var(--typography-family-body);font-size:1rem;height:32px;line-height:1rem;max-width:32px;padding:0;text-align:center;width:32px;@media (min-width:2000px){max-width:30px}}.react-calendar__month-view__days,.react-calendar__month-view__weekdays{column-gap:8px;@media (min-width:768px){column-gap:23.6px}@media (min-width:2000px){column-gap:23.8px}}button.react-calendar__tile--active{border-radius:6px;outline:1.5px solid #fff;outline-offset:4px}abbr[title]{text-decoration:none}